Kotak Centang

Anda dapat menggunakan CheckBox di antarmuka pengguna (UI) aplikasi Anda untuk mewakili opsi yang dapat dipilih atau dihapus pengguna. Anda bisa menggunakan satu kotak centang atau Anda bisa mengelompokkan dua atau beberapa kotak centang.

Grafik berikut menunjukkan berbagai status CheckBox.

Kontrol kotak centang di berbagai kondisi.

Gaya dan templat

Anda dapat memodifikasi default ControlTemplate untuk memberi CheckBox kontrol tampilan yang unik. Untuk informasi selengkapnya, lihat Apa itu gaya dan templat? dan Cara membuat templat untuk kontrol.

Properti konten

Untuk kontrol CheckBox, properti kontennya adalah Content. Gunakan properti ini untuk menentukan teks atau konten yang muncul di samping kotak centang.

Bagian

Elemen kontrol CheckBox tidak menetapkan bagian templat apa pun.

Keadaan visual

Tabel berikut mencantumkan status visual untuk CheckBox kontrol.

Nama VisualState Nama VisualStateGroup Description
Biasa CommonStates Kontrol berada dalam keadaan normal.
MouseOver CommonStates Mouse berada di atas kontrol.
Ditekan CommonStates Kontrol ditekan.
Disabled CommonStates Kontrol dinonaktifkan.
Terfokus FocusStates Kontrol memiliki fokus keyboard.
Tidak fokus FocusStates Kontrol tidak memiliki fokus keyboard.
Telah Diperiksa CheckStates Kontrol diperiksa.
Tidak Dicentang CheckStates Kontrol tidak dicentang.
Tidak ditentukan CheckStates Kontrol dalam keadaan tidak stabil.
Sah StatusValidasi Kontrol valid dan tidak memiliki kesalahan validasi.
FokusTidakValid StatusValidasi Kontrol memiliki kesalahan validasi dan memiliki fokus keyboard.
Tidak valid dan Tidak Difokuskan StatusValidasi Kontrol memiliki kesalahan validasi tetapi tidak memiliki fokus keyboard.

Lihat juga